Supply Chain Localization Manager

The Professionals

  • Riyadh
  • Permanent
  • Full-time
  • 2 days ago
Resposibilities:
  • Analyze and report the local ecosystem for shipbuilding activity.
  • Cross-categorize a list of items used for different projects.
  • Scan the market and develop an approved local suppliers list for each item category.
Follow up with potential local suppliers to supply items with the required specifications.Follow the internal process for technical approval of items, including testing or third-party certification.Ensure that local suppliers have the necessary capability to meet our requirements for each item.Identify the localization rate and value for each item and equipment.Contact potential international suppliers and discuss the possibility of manufacturing in the local market.Collaborate with procurement to negotiate prices, best terms, and conditions, and finalize local supplier contracts.Monitor and ensure compliance with the required supply chain localization rate for each project.Manage the collection and supply of acceptance criteria and update the localization crediting value for each project.Requiremenets:Bachelor's degree in Supply Chain Management, Business Administration, or a related field.Proven experience in supply chain management, localization, or related fields.Strong analytical skills and ability to interpret data effectively.Excellent communication and negotiation skills.Knowledge of the shipbuilding industry and related supply chain processes.Ability to work effectively in a cross-functional team environment.Detail-oriented with strong organizational skills.Proficiency in project management and supplier relationship management.Minimum 10 years in shipbuilding, production, and supplier development.

The Professionals